Conventional Audio Visual Installation: A Device-Oriented Approach
Conventional audio visual installation focuses on installing individual devices according to their specific functions without connecting them into a unified ecosystem.
For example, a meeting room may include a television, projector, conference camera, wireless microphone, and sound system. Although each device performs well individually, they operate independently and require separate controls.
Users typically need to turn on the display manually, connect a laptop with an HDMI cable, activate the conferencing camera, adjust the speaker volume, configure the microphone, and finally launch the video conferencing application.
While this approach is relatively simple and usually requires a lower initial investment, daily operation becomes more complicated as additional devices are added to the room.
The more equipment involved, the greater the possibility of technical issues, operational errors, and wasted time before meetings even begin.
Audio Visual Integration: One Intelligent and Connected Ecosystem
Unlike conventional installation, Audio Visual Integration is designed to make every device work together as one intelligent system.
Displays, cameras, microphones, speakers, lighting controls, room scheduling systems, and automation platforms are connected through a centralized control system. Instead of operating each device individually, users manage everything from a single interface.
Imagine entering a meeting room and simply pressing the “Start Meeting” button.
Within seconds, the display powers on, the conferencing camera activates, the microphones connect automatically, the audio system adjusts itself, the room lighting changes to presentation mode, and the preferred video conferencing platform launches instantly.
The entire meeting room becomes ready without requiring multiple manual steps.
This seamless experience represents the biggest advantage of Audio Visual Integration. The focus shifts from managing technology to improving collaboration and productivity.

Comparing How Both Systems Work
The most noticeable difference lies in the way each system operates.
With conventional installation, every device functions independently. If one component changes, users often need to adjust other devices manually. This process increases complexity and creates unnecessary delays.
Audio Visual Integration, on the other hand, enables devices to communicate with one another automatically.
Instead of treating displays, cameras, microphones, and speakers as separate products, the system manages them as a single coordinated environment.
This centralized approach minimizes user intervention and significantly improves operational efficiency.
For organizations that conduct multiple meetings every day, even a few minutes saved during each session can translate into substantial productivity gains over time.

Maintenance and System Management
Maintenance is another area where the differences become increasingly apparent.
With conventional audio visual installation, every device operates independently. When a problem occurs, IT personnel must inspect each component separately to identify the source of the issue.
This troubleshooting process can become time-consuming, especially when multiple brands and technologies are involved.
Audio Visual Integration simplifies system management.
Since every component is connected within a centralized ecosystem, monitoring, diagnostics, and maintenance become much more efficient. Documentation is also more organized, allowing technical teams to resolve issues faster while minimizing downtime.
For businesses that rely on uninterrupted daily operations, this advantage can make a significant difference.

Automation Capabilities
Automation is one of the strongest advantages of Audio Visual Integration.
In a conventional installation, users perform nearly every action manually. They need to power on displays, configure microphones, select input sources, connect conferencing devices, and adjust room settings before each meeting.
An integrated system transforms this experience completely.
With a single command, the system can automatically:
- Turn on the display.
- Activate the conferencing camera.
- Enable microphones.
- Adjust the room lighting.
- Power the audio system.
- Launch the preferred video conferencing platform.
These automated workflows reduce preparation time while creating a more consistent and professional meeting experience.

Common Mistakes Companies Still Make
Many organizations assume that purchasing premium equipment automatically results in a high-quality meeting room.
Unfortunately, expensive hardware alone cannot guarantee a seamless user experience.
Some of the most common mistakes include:
- Purchasing devices from different manufacturers without considering compatibility.
- Focusing only on hardware instead of complete system design.
- Ignoring network infrastructure requirements.
- Selecting the cheapest installation rather than the most suitable solution.
- Failing to consider future expansion plans.
These decisions often lead to higher operational costs, additional upgrades, and recurring technical issues that could have been avoided through proper system planning.
